Market Segments Reflect Rapid Clinical Adoption
On the basis of application, oncology was the largest segment in 2025 and represented 38% of market revenue as precision oncology continues to gain clinical acceptance around the world. With the increasing availability of advanced genetic testing and early diagnosis of diseases, rare genetic disorders are projected to witness fastest growth through 2035.
In products and services, in 2025, instruments and equipment accounted for approximately 44% market due to continuous investments on sequencing platforms & laboratory infrastructure. At the same time, the services segment is expected to grow fastest as more and more pharmaceutical companies start outsourcing genomic testing, analytical services, and clinical research.
By technology scope, Next-Generation Sequencing (NGS) continued to dominate the market by accounting for nearly 52% of the worldwide revenue share in 2025, owing to its wide application in research and clinical diagnostics. Microarray technologies are predicted to achieve the fastest growth in this period owing to rising applications within gene expression analysis and large-scale genetic screening.
By end user, diagnostic laboratories expected to provide nearly 36% of market revenue in 2025 and pharmaceutical and biotechnology companies projected to experience the most future growth as genomics are more heavily tied into drug discovery/precision therapeutics.

Regional Markets Strengthen Global Expansion
In 2025, North America continued its lead as the largest regional market in the world with a share of global revenue equivalent to 42.62% due to advanced healthcare infrastructure, higher funding for research activity and early adoption of genomic technologies in the region. The U.S. accounted for about 78% of North America revenue within the region. In the U.S., Genomic Medicine Market for 2025 was valued at USD 9.93 billion and is projected to reach USD32.9 billion by 2035, expanding at a 12.74% CAGR
Rapid growth of the Asia Pacific region is projected during the forecast period, due to rising government investment in biotechnology, precision medicine and healthcare modernization. Regional revenue in China represented nearly 42%, as rapid sequencing capacity expansion and increasing clinical uptake continued.
For Europe, the UK accounted for some 30% of regional revenue while Brazil represented 51% of Latin America. The largest share of Middle East & Africa revenue came from the United Arab Emirates, at around 33%, due to continuous healthcare transformation processes.
Industry Leaders Advance Genomic Innovation
More technological milestones for the genomic medicine industry In 2025, Illumina launched the NovaSeq X Plus sequencing platform, which allows higher throughput and reduces cost-per-sequenced-base. Key recent achievements include the approval by the FDA of gene-editing Casgevy with Vertex Pharmaceuticals and CRISPR Therapeutics in December 2023 which is a breakthrough for gene-editing therapies. Thermo Fisher Scientific and Pfizer Inc. announced in May 2023 the launch of NGS-based cancer testing at thousands of more labs globally in over 30 countries. This partnership is helping to advance precision oncology into daily routine practice.
